Output edbf17e0d75d7b390ba6155e1ab90d41059a2b4b88d0f80205310af54ba23740:40

value
26976
script pubkey
OP_0 OP_PUSHBYTES_20 d85c4405d73c46423f2987add5cb95876db6902a
address
bc1qmpwygpwh83ryy0efs7katju4sakmdyp26k035w
transaction
edbf17e0d75d7b390ba6155e1ab90d41059a2b4b88d0f80205310af54ba23740
spent
true